what does it mean by writing [~,idx] in code?

241 views (last 30 days)
for p= 4:4:population
dists= total_dist(rand_pair(p-3:p));
[~,idx]=min(dists);
best = routes(idx,:);
what idx, ~ means??

The ~ represents an output that is discarded. It is essentially equivalent to:
[dummy,idx]=min(dists);
clear dummy
For this example, the code wants to work with the index of the minimum value, not the value itself, so the minimum value that is returned is discarded and only the index is retained.

When you see
>> [a,b,c] = function(...)
then a,b, and c are the output of a function. If you do not want one of the outputs of a function, then you can replace it with the ~ symbol:
>> [a,~,c] = function(...)
and then b will not be output.

To clarify, the syntax doesn't actually prevent the function from producing the output ... it just causes MATLAB to ignore the output and automatically clear it instead of assigning it to a workspace variable. So using the syntax makes your code cleaner looking but the function will still use the same resources (time & memory) to run.
